tévék. Konzolok. Projektorok és tartozékok. Technológiák. Digitális TV

A div középre állítása és egyéb pozicionálási finomságok. Középre igazítás: CSS elrendezés Középre igazítás parancs html-ben

Az elemek vízszintes és függőleges igazítása elvégezhető különböző utak. A módszer megválasztása függ az elem típusától (blokk vagy inline), elhelyezésének típusától, méretétől stb.

1. Vízszintes igazítás a blokk/oldal közepéhez

1.1. Ha meg van adva a blokkszélesség:

div (szélesség: 300 képpont; margó: 0 automatikus; /*az elem vízszintes középre helyezése a szülőblokkon belül*/)

Ha egy soron belüli elemet így akarunk igazítani, akkor a következőt kell beállítani: block;

1.2. Ha egy blokk egy másik blokkba van beágyazva, és a szélessége nincs megadva:

.wrapper(text-align: center;)

1.3. Ha a blokk szélességű, és a szülőblokk közepére kell helyezni:

.wrapper (pozíció: relatív; /*beállítja a szülőblokk relatív pozícionálását, hogy aztán abszolút el tudjuk helyezni a blokkot benne*/) .box ( szélesség: 400px; pozíció: abszolút; bal: 50%; margin-left: -200px / *eltolja balra a blokkot a szélességének felével egyenlő távolsággal*/ )

1.4. Ha a blokkok szélessége nincs megadva, középre igazíthatja őket egy szülő burkolóblokk segítségével:

.wrapper (text-align: center; /*a blokk tartalmát középre helyezi*/) .box ( display: inline-block; /*a blokkok sorbarendezése vízszintesen*/ margó jobbra: -0,25em /*a blokkok közötti megfelelő szóköz eltávolítása*/ )

2. Függőleges igazítás

2.1. Ha a szöveg egy sort foglal el, például a gombok és menüpontok esetében:

.button ( magasság: 50 képpont; vonalmagasság: 50 képpont; )

2.2. Blokk függőleges igazítása a szülőblokkon belül:

.wrapper (pozíció: relatív;).doboz (magasság: 100px; pozíció: abszolút; felső: 50%; margó: -50px 0 0 0; )

2.3. Függőleges igazítás táblázattípus szerint:

.wrapper ( kijelző: táblázat; szélesség: 100%; ) .box ( kijelző: táblázatcella; magasság: 100 képpont; szöveg igazítása: középre; függőleges igazítás: középre; )

2.4. Ha egy blokknak adott a szélessége és magassága, és a szülőblokk közepére kell helyezni:

.wrapper ( pozíció: relatív; ) .box ( magasság: 100 képpont; szélesség: 100 képpont; pozíció: abszolút; felül: 0; jobbra: 0; alul: 0; balra: 0; margó: automatikus; túlcsordulás: automatikus; /*to a tartalom nem terjedt el */ )

2.5. Abszolút pozicionálás az oldal/blokk közepén CSS3 transzformációval:

ha az elemhez méretek vannak megadva

div ( szélesség: 300 képpont; /*blokk szélességének beállítása*/ magasság: 100 képpont; /*blokk magasságának beállítása*/ transzformáció: translate(-50%, -50%); pozíció: abszolút; felső: 50 % bal: 50% ;

ha az elemnek nincsenek méretei és nem üres

Itt egy kis szöveg

h1 ( margó: 0; átalakítás: fordítás (-50%, -50%); pozíció: abszolút; felül: 50%; bal: 50%; )

2.5. Abszolút blokk pozicionálás

az oldal közepére helyezve



div ( szélesség: 500 képpont; magasság: 100 képpont; /* ha a magasság nincs kifejezetten beállítva, akkor 100% lesz */ pozíció: abszolút; felső: 0; alsó: 0; bal: 0; jobb: 0; margó: auto ;)

a blokk közepén

.wrapper ( pozíció: abszolút; ) .box ( szélesség: 100 képpont; magasság: 100 képpont; /* ha a magasság nincs kifejezetten beállítva, akkor 100% lesz */ pozíció: abszolút; felül: 0; alul: 0; balra: 0 jobbra: 0;

ablakok : internet böngésző 3.0+, Firefox 1.0+, Google Chrome, Opera 3.51 – 6.xx és 9.0+, Safari 3.1+, SeaMonkey 1.0+ [1].

Linux: Firefox 1.0+, Chromium, Opera 5.0 – 6.xx és 9.0+, SeaMonkey 1.0+ [2].

Az oldal tartalmának központosítása a böngészőablak látható területén HTML használatával - CSS nélkül. A tároló, amelyben a weboldal tartalma elhelyezkedni fog, középen van igazítva - szélességben és magasságban: [Példaoldal megnyitása].

És a Netscape 2.02-4.80 és az Offbyone verziókban is. A Netscape 2.02 - 4.80-ban az oldal tartalma a böngészőablak látható területének bal felső sarkába tolódik el, mivel ezek a programok helyet foglalnak el a görgetősávok számára.

És a Netscape 2.02-4.80-ban is. A Netscape 2.02 - 4.80-ban az oldal tartalma a böngészőablak látható területének bal felső sarkába tolódik el, mivel ezek a programok helyet foglalnak el a görgetősávok számára.

Aliosque subditos et theme

Számos program létezik képernyőképek készítésére DOS-ban. Például a SNARF. Ezzel az alkalmazással a legtöbb esetben tudtunk képernyőképeket készíteni. A SNARF által készített képernyőképek (.BMP fájlok) minősége is a legjobbnak bizonyult a tesztelt programok közül: ScreenThief, VideoThief, FLIP, GRABBER, SNARF. A SNARF használata az alapértelmezett beállításokkal egyszerű, de van egy hátránya – a SNARF mindig abba a mappába menti a képernyőképet, amelyben a felhasználó éppen tartózkodik. Ami kényelmetlen vagy elfogadhatatlan lehet. És nincs nyilvánvaló módja ennek megváltoztatására. Van azonban egy megoldás. Az eredeti ötlet ezen a linken található. Ami alapján a következők születtek: 1. SNARF [Letöltés] 2. Használat szöveg szerkesztő nyissa meg a SNARF.EXE fájlt szöveges módban, keresse meg a snarf000.bmp fájlt, és váltson át a következőre: s:scn000.bin 3. Hozzon létre batch file, például az S.BAT, amelyben a SNARF.EXE indítósoron kívül lesz egy parancs egy pszeudo-meghajtó S: létrehozására annak a mappának az elérési útjára, amelybe a SNARF futásakor a képernyőképek mentésre kerülnek. A mappa és elérési útja bármi lehet: C:\SOFT\SNARF.EXE SUBST S: C:\SCREENS\ 4. Futtassa a SNARF-t: S [vagy S.BAT] 5. Képernyőkép készítése: Alt + S két hangjelzés legyen. Az első az elején, a második pedig a folyamat sikeres befejezésének jele. A képernyőképek elkészítése után el kell lépnie a mappába, ahová azokat elmentette, és le kell cserélnie a fájl kiterjesztését .BIN-ről .BMP SNARF-re - Freeware.

CSS függőleges igazítás blokk elem szöveget és képeket tartalmaz. A blokk és a beépített elemek különböző kombinációihoz működik. Példa: CSS függőleges igazítás CSS HTML/XHTML függőleges igazítás. Kód:

CSS függőleges igazítás
CSS függőleges igazítás
CSS. Kód: .parent (pozíció: relatív; bal: 0px; felül: 0px; magasság: 200px; kijelző: táblázat;) .child (pozíció: relatív; bal: 0px; felül: 0px; kijelző: táblázatcella; függőleges igazítás : középen;).childcontent (pozíció: relatív; bal: 0px; felül: 0px;) Megjegyzés: a .parent és .childcontent lehet balra igazítva ("float: left;") vagy igazítás nélkül, de így függőlegesen CSS-igazítás dolgozott, a .gyerek "lebegés: balra;" nélkül legyen. [ 1 ] És Netscape 6.01+, Mozilla 0.6+ verziókban is. [ 2 ] És Netscape 6.01+, Mozilla 0.6+ verziókban is.

A látogatónak könnyen meg kell találnia a szükséges információkat az oldalon. Erre, valamint valamilyen kifejezés kifejezésére, különféle HTML címkék. Ez a cikk a táblázatokkal való munka árnyalatait, különösen azok igazítását tárgyalja.

Alapvető finomságok

Először is meg kell jegyezni, hogy ez grafikus forma Az adatok bemutatása lehetővé teszi az információk strukturálását, ami nagyban megkönnyíti azok asszimilációját. Szinte bármilyen tartalom lehet a táblázat celláiban: a szövegtől a videóig. Fontos figyelembe venni nemcsak a méretet, hanem a helyét is.

Hogyan állítsuk középre magát az asztalt

Leggyakrabban a táblázatot az oldal közepére kell rendezni, bár kezdetben az oldal bal oldalára van nyomva. A középre igazításhoz a margó tulajdonságát auto értékre kell állítani.

...

Ez azt eredményezi, hogy a táblázat behúzása automatikusan kiszámításra kerül. Ezt követően a táblázat az oldal közepére kerül.

Középre igazítás a cellákban

Ugyanilyen gyakran kell az adatokat a cella közepéhez igazítani. Ennek három módja van: vízszintes, függőleges és abszolút. A nevükből kiderül, hogy melyik tengelyen történik majd a központosítás. Mindenesetre a címke használatos , egy sorban egy adott sejtért felelős. Ezután hozzá kell rendelnie a valign (függőleges) és/vagy a align (vízszintes) attribútumokhoz a "center" értéket, a feladattól függően:

Szöveg a cella közepén

Ha ezt a formázást szabványossá szeretné tenni a teljes webhelyre vagy oldalra (hogy ne írjon át minden táblát), akkor CSS-stílusokat kell használnia. Ehhez adja hozzá a következő kódot a címkén belül :

Ezzel a módszerrel beállíthatja az igazítást egy adott cellához, oszlophoz, sorhoz vagy a teljes táblázat egészéhez. Amint látja, bármelyik módszer nagyon egyszerű.

A kívánt beviteli elemek „checkbox” típusú kiválasztásához használhatja a választót ':checkbox'. Példa:

Ahol kezelő— egy kezelő, amely a változási esemény bekövetkezésekor hívódik meg

Munka a visszahívási objektummal a jQuery alkalmazásban: A visszahívási függvények listájának használata

A Callbacks objektum a jQuery-ben lehetővé teszi valami, például a visszahívások listájának létrehozását, amely a fire() segédprogram meghívásakor kerül végrehajtásra. Ezenkívül a fire() metódus meghívásakor átadható néhány argumentum, amelyet az egyes visszahívási függvények használni fognak. Most több példán keresztül megvizsgáljuk, hogyan működik ez.

A fókusz elvesztésének elkapása. blur() metódus a jQuery-ben

A jQuery blur() metódusa lehetővé teszi, hogy egy kezelőt rendeljen az oldalon egy adott elemhez, amely azonnal meghívásra kerül, amint az elemről elveszik a fókusz. Kezdetben ez az esemény elsősorban az űrlapelemekre vonatkozott – azonban a bemeneti címkék legújabb verziói a böngészők képesek feldolgozni ez az esemény szinte minden típusú DOM elemhez.

Tartalmat szúr be a kiválasztott objektum tartalma elé. előtt() metódus a jQuery-ben

A jQuery before() metódusa lehetővé teszi, hogy meghatározott tartalmat vagy objektumokat illesszen be a megadott objektumok mindegyikének tartalma elé.
A metódus szintaxisa egyszerű:

1 .before(content, )

Második variáció:

1 .before(függvény)

jQuery. attr() metódus. Attribútum beszerzése vagy hozzáadása elemhez

A jQuery nagyon egyszerűvé teszi a kívánt elem attribútumainak elérését, lekérve az értékét, vagy fordítva, beállítva és módosítva. Az ilyen manipulációkhoz az attr() metódust használjuk.

Az .appendTo() metódus a jQuery-ben. Tartalom hozzáadása az elemek végéhez

Az appendTo() metódus lényegében ugyanazt a feladatot hajtja végre, mint az append() metódus. A különbség általában csak a szintaxisban van. Ha az append()-hez megadjuk a kívánt szelektort, hozzáadva ezt a metódust, ahol zárójelben megadjuk, hogy pontosan mit kell hozzáadni a megadott objektum tartalmának végéhez, akkor az appendTo()-hoz mit kell hozzáadni már nincs zárójelben metódusparaméterként, és közvetlenül a metódus előtt, mint az appendTo() meghívó objektuma. A különbség jobban megérthető a következő példával.

jQuery .animate() módszer: Animálja a képeket, szöveget és bármit

Az .animate() metódus lehetővé teszi animációs effektusok létrehozását maguknak az objektumoknak a CSS tulajdonságainak felhasználásával. A módszernek két változata van, különböző számú átadott paraméterrel

Videók konvertálása a Movavi segítségével

BAN BEN Utóbbi időben Annak érdekében, hogy jól kihasználjam a munkába és visszautazás idejét, igyekszem előre letölteni többet a telefonomra hasznos videókat görgők. A telefon Androidon működik, és legutóbb olyan problémába ütköztem, amikor az okostelefon valamilyen okból megtagadta a videó lejátszását AVI formátumban. Hogy a lejátszó gyenge-e, vagy az operációs rendszer sajátosságai, nem tudom. A probléma megoldása azonban nem tartott sokáig: találtam az interneten egy meglehetősen működőképes videokonvertálót, amely nem csak az egyik formátumból a másikba tudja konvertálni, hanem az eszköz jellemzőit figyelembe véve fájlt is készít. Itt rövid leírása Hogyan kell használni ezt a csodálatos programot.

Helló! Folytassuk az alapok elsajátítását HTML nyelv. Lássuk, mit kell írni a szöveg középponthoz, szélességhez vagy szélekhez igazításához.

Ha rátérünk a dolgokra, nézzük meg, hogyan lehet a szöveget három részre helyezni különböző utak. Az utolsó kettő közvetlenül a stíluslaphoz kapcsolódik. Ez lehet egy CSS-fájl, amely csatlakozik a webhely oldalaihoz, és meghatározza azok megjelenését.

1. módszer – közvetlen munka a HTML-lel

Valójában nagyon egyszerű. Lásd alább a példát.

Igazítsa a bekezdést középre.

Ha más módon kell áthelyeznie a szövegrészleteket, akkor a „center” paraméter helyett adja meg a következő értékeket:

  • igazítás – a szöveg igazítása az oldal szélességéhez;
  • jobb – a jobb szélen;
  • balra - balra.

Hasonló módon mozgathatja a fejlécekben (h1, h2) és a tárolóban (div) található tartalmat.

2. és 3. módszer – stílusok használata

A fent bemutatott kialakítás kissé átalakítható. A hatás ugyanaz lesz. Ehhez meg kell írnia az alábbi kódot.

Szövegblokk.

Ebben a formában a kód közvetlenül a HTML-be van írva a szövegtartalom középpontjába.

Van egy másik alternatív módja az eredmények elérésének. Néhány lépést meg kell tennie.

1. lépés: A fő kódba írja be

Szöveges anyag.

2. lépés: A mellékelt CSS-fájlba írja be a következő kódot:

Rovno (text-align:center;)

Megjegyzem, a „rovno” szó csak egy osztály neve, amelyet másként is lehet nevezni. Ez a programozó belátására van bízva.

Hasonlóan, a HTML-ben könnyen lehet szöveget középre igazítani, igazítani és az oldal jobb vagy bal széléhez igazítani. Amint látja, sokkal több lehetőség van a cél eléréséhez.

Csak néhány kérdés:

  • Informatikai non-profit projektet folytat?
  • Azt szeretnéd, hogy a weboldalad jól működjön? kereső motorok?
  • Szeretnél online bevételt keresni?

Ha minden válasz pozitív, akkor nézze meg a webhelyfejlesztés integrált megközelítését. Az információ különösen akkor lesz hasznos, ha a WordPress CMS-en fut.

Szeretném felhívni a figyelmet arra, hogy a saját weboldala csak egy lehetőség a sok közül, hogy passzív vagy aktív bevételt szerezzen az interneten. A blogom az online pénzügyi lehetőségekről szól.

Dolgozott valaha a forgalmi arbitrázs, szövegírás vagy más olyan tevékenységi területen, amely távoli együttműködés révén elsődleges vagy kiegészítő bevételt generál? Erről és még sok másról most a blogom oldalain tájékozódhat.

A jövőben még jó néhányat publikálok hasznos információ. Maradj kapcsolatban. Ha szeretné, e-mailben is feliratkozhat a Workip frissítéseire. Az előfizetési űrlap lent található.



Kapcsolódó kiadványok